I have read a lot of good things about the RazoRock/Cadet open comb razors. RazoRock being marketed by the ItalianBarber.com and Cadet marketed by ShaveAbuck.com. These razors are inexpensive, made in India units that boast very good production quality (for a sub $30 razor they often beat Merkur in that department).
I have been moving towards open comb steadily. I also have been increasing the aggressiveness of the OC's I try. I started with Merkur 41, which was way too mild for me. Then I tried Gillette New long and short combs. I ended up liking the Long comb and feeling that short comb is too mild. I also have and really like Gillette Big Fellow with a New Improved head. Now I decided to try the RazoRock Little Bastone OC, which sells for amazing $20 at IB. When I got it I noticed a few rough spots in the top plate that were left there before chrome plating. Chrome on this razor is outstanding. At least as good as Merkur, maybe better. The handle of the Little Bastone is very nice. It's the short handle and a bit thicker than a ball end tech with lots of knurling and is very comfortable. The balance of the razor is a bit towards the head, but not bad at all.
Now for the shave. WOW! This is definitely the most aggressive OC razor I tried and I was a bit worried, but my worries were completely unfounded. This thing shaves like a dream! It is aggressive, no doubt about it, but it's very well behaved. I used it here and there when I first got it and I did pair the RR OC head with Ikon bulldog handle, which made the razor even better and balanced a bit lower from the head. I still used my Gillette OC (New LC and NI) and my Progress and at that point I had a vintage Merkur Slant that I enjoyed, but again and again I got better shaves with the RR OC. At this point I have been using that razor exclusively just because I get such great results with it.
I like it so much I have now ordered a Cadet OC just to have a backup. I got rid of the slant, New SC, Old and the Merkur OC. None of them shave anywhere near the RR/Cadet OC.
